The interview consists of two parts. First, it takes 10 minutes to introduce yourself. Secondly, the employer takes 50 minutes to ask questions and communicate with the interviewer. On the whole, there is some pressure in the interview, which may be related to the psychological quality and experience of the interviewer.
Multiple one on ones and a research presentation. Asked to present on previous work and future interests. Asked about knowledge of the field and how research could compliment the research program of the lab.
